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Battle lines drawn in the CT dose reduction arena

Over the past ten years, Computed Tomography (CT) vendors have been in a fierce race to capitalise on the trend for multi-slice CT equipment. However, in the last three years, increasing concerns over radiation exposure from CT examinations have driven a focus on dose-reduction, and CT product development has followed suit. As battle lines are drawn in the dose-reduction arena, InMedica (www.in-medica.com) analyses the competition for CT slices in its new report "The World Market for CT and PET-CT Equipment." Importantly, what will this mean for dose-reduction?
